Skip to product information
1 of 5

Vinyl Wall Decal Sticker Small Tree With Big Leaves #1106

Vinyl Wall Decal Sticker Small Tree With Big Leaves #1106

Regular price $61.98 USD
Regular price Sale price $61.98 USD
Sale